MPEG 750 is a high molecular weight product that belongs to methoxy polyoxyethylene glycols. The product is intended mainly for the construction industry. The average molecular weight is 750 g/mol. The product is a white compact paste or solid. The compound is a polymer with high solubility in water and a slight odour. The active substance content in the product is about 100%.
MPEG 750 is mainly used for the production of polycarboxylate ether (PCE) superplasticizers for concrete. It is used in esterification reactions, e.g. with methacrylic acid which is further subjected to a polymerization process. The resulting products are the main components of concrete admixtures that reduce the amount of batch water in cement concrete.
Comb polymers, resulting from emulsion polymerization using MPEG 750, are used in paint and varnish production. They are dispersants for organic and inorganic pigments.
